Massaging from the beginning wouldn’t cause a PE or Stroke. It’s preventative care. It’s only advised not to if the patient has a condition affecting their coagulation or smth like DVT. If Nick disregarded Horua for days on end and then started moving his limbs, then possibly. But if he moved his limbs on a regular, daily basis (like described), then it’s preventative care.
Main point is that you are supposed to massage because if you don’t, a clot will form. It’s completely different if the patient has DVT, then sure, massaging could release the clot, but that’s not happening in this situation
Muscle movements and gravity are the main determinants in blood flow for veins since they do not have the same amount of muscle in their walls when compared to arteries. Thus massaging extremities not only reduces the chances of muscle wasting, but also the chances of a thrombus forming, it detaching and becoming an embolus, an said embolus travelling to the lungs, and the patient dying from a pulmonary embolism and/or stroke.
